Captain Stag CS Classics One Pole Tent DX Octagon 460UV Main Features

The "CS Classics One Pole Tent DX Octagon 460UV" is stored in a state of storage. It weighs approximately 17kg, so it can be stored compactly in a bag, but it is quite heavy.

The " Captain Stag CS Classics One Pole Tent DX Octagon 460UV " (hereinafter referred to as DX Octagon 460UV ) is quite large among Captain Stag's tents, with a size of approximately 460 x 460 x 300cm tall. Generally, this tent is a very large for me, as a family of three with my son and wife, but there was a big reason why I was still curious about this tent. This you can use kerosene stoves Captain Stag x Corona Oil Stove SL-51CS . "

Needless to say, the cold in Hokkaido, where I am the main field, is at a level that is beyond imagination. It is not uncommon to use a stove at home until around April in spring, and in autumn, you often use a stove from around the second half of September. Therefore, it is undoubtedly a great advantage to be able to use a stove in a tent when camping, and it is an incredibly valuable benefit not only for people like me who live in Hokkaido, but also for people who love winter camping. This tent also has many other features that create a comfortable camping life, such as a spacious living space of approximately 10.7 tatami mats, excellent ventilation, and an inner tent that separates private spaces from common areas, while also offering affordable prices.

By the way, Captain Stag's tents that can be used with this limited-edition kerosene stove 460UV and 400UV chose DX Octagon 460UV to enjoy camping in a spacious and relaxed atmosphere It's also a good idea to choose 400UV depending on the number of people and preferences

Despite its size, the DX Octagon 460UV was easier to install than expected. There were so many pegs that we had to type in, so it took a surprisingly long time.

    Testing tent + spot cooler with heat index above 31°C

    The highest temperature in Chitose City was expected to be 32 degrees on the day, but the temperature measured was over 36 degrees and the WBGT (heat index) was 31 degrees Celsius, which is a dangerous level.

    Looking at the weather forecasts across the country, there are forecasts in the low 30s, but in Chitose, Hokkaido, where I live, the temperatures only rise to the low 30s, so I thought it would be a little difficult to find useful, so I tested the DX Octagon 460UV and the spot cooler for a sunny day with a maximum temperature of 32 degrees.

    To measure temperature and other factors, I used the Kenko Tokiner ``Black Ball Heat Stroke Meter'' to measure temperature, humidity, and WBGT values ​​(heat index) using the ``Kenko Tokiner's ``Black Ball Heat Stroke Meter''. Due to differences in measurement methods, there are often differences in the temperatures shown by the thermometer and the black ball heat stroke meter, the black ball heat stroke meter will be listed in the main text

    the DX Octagon 460UV available on days exposed to direct sunlight, we have installed the to make it even more demanding at Forever Camping Paradise which is close to New Chitose Airport The DX Octagon 460UV is a fairly large tent with a floor area of ​​approximately 10.7 tatami mats, and can be installed much easier than you would expect by securing floor seats and other items firmly with pegs. However, the thing that bothered me was the size, but since there were so many pegs that I had to drive in, it took me a few minutes to assemble them together.

    Incidentally, when measuring the temperature outdoors exposed to direct sunlight next to the completed tent, the results showed WBGT (heat index): 31°C, temperature: 36.3°C, humidity: 55%, and guidelines for daily life were dangerous. Even though it's a campsite with well-ventilated grass, it's at this temperature, so it's a level that you wouldn't want to imagine how hot it would be in a closed tent with the sun set up.

    The tent that I purposely set up on the sun was hotter than I expected. Outside of testing, we highly recommend installing tents for summer camping in the shade.

    The temperature in the closed day tent has risen to a whopping 45.1 degrees Celsius.

    The CS Classic Hexa Grill Table Set was installed in the center of the closed "DX Octagon 460UV" by Hinata, and thermometers and other items were arranged on top of it.

    A DX Octagon 460UV was installed, a CS Classic Hexagrill Table Set was set in the center, and a thermometer and a black ball heat stroke meter were installed on top of this. Furthermore, we have arranged two easy-to-use GI beds a CS Classics aluminum back bench , a Trekker The Light Chair , and a CS Black Label Low Style Solo bench the DX Octagon 460UV and sealing it, I observed a while after a thermometer and other results showed that the WBGT value (heat index) was 34.8°C, air temperature 45.1°C, humidity 32%, and the level was dangerous. Just being in the tent makes me sweat gush out, and it's not at the level where I can be inside with my child. A sealed tent in the daytime exposed to direct sunlight is truly "a life-threatening and dangerous heat."

    Cool for 1 hour with Chest Gen's Spot Air Conditioner QL03 and JH01 Circulator.

    Chestnut Gen's "JH01 Circulator" (left) and "Spot Air Conditioner QL03" (right). The heat exhaust duct is placed outside the tent.

    Spot Air Conditioner QL03 " and " JH01 Circulator " were placed to cool the room of the DX Octagon 460UV which has become so hot that it exceeds 45 degrees the Spot Air Conditioner QL03 , a recent article a portable spot cooler that is very cool in both camper vans and at home It's a moderate size for cooling a camper van, but I'm concerned that it's a bit lacking in power to cool DX Octagon 460UV Normally, we would like to choose a model with a higher output power even with Gen's spot cooler, but this time we conducted an experiment with the spot air conditioner QL03 In addition, in order to spread the cold air from the spot cooler the DX Octagon 460UV , we have installed a 3D swingable JH01 circulator that can swing not only horizontally but also vertically.

    the spot air conditioner QL03 cooled for about 15 minutes after about 1 hour in cool air and strong.

    ■Cooling results for "Spot Air Conditioner QL03" + "JH01 Circulator"

    Time (min)WBGT value (heat index ℃)Temperature (℃)Humidity (%)level
    034.845.132danger
    1532.240.439danger
    3030.637.643Highly vigilant
    4531.639.639danger
    6032.140.636danger

    We conducted a cooling experiment in the hottest hour, roughly from around 1:30 noon, but the spot air conditioner QL03 and JH01 circulator, the temperature dropped to about 7 degrees Celsius, and the WBGT value (heat index) also fell from the highest 34.8℃ to about 30.6℃. However, since it was the most sunny time, the end result was not so much that the risk of heat stroke was eliminated.

    However, if the spot air conditioners were not used, there is a good chance that the temperature would have been even hotter from 45.1 degrees Celsius, and the interior would have been no longer at a temperature that humans could be in. Thinking about it like this is a clear result of how dangerous it is to find inside a sealed tent in the "dangerous, life-threatening heat."

    The heat exhaust duct of the Spot Air Conditioner QL03 is brought out of the tent to allow heat to escape. The good thing about the Spot Air Conditioner QL03 is that it can be used with this alone.

    The Haier JA-SP25U spot air conditioner has 2.5kW at 60Hz and 2.2kW at 50Hz, so it has slightly higher cooling capacity than the 2.1kW (60Hz) and 1.8kW (50Hz) Spot Air Conditioner QL03, and I thought it would give better results, so I borrowed this as well and actually conducted a cooling experiment for about an hour.

    ■Cooling results for "Haier JA-SP25U Spot Air Conditioner" + "JH01 Circulator"

    Time (min)WBGT value (heat index ℃)Temperature (℃)Humidity (%)level
    033.442.336danger
    1532.342.430danger
    3032.440.533danger
    4530.839.833Highly vigilant
    6030.740.231Highly vigilant

    This is the result of measurements taken from around 2:30pm to 3:30pm, so the sunlight may be slightly less than when the spot air conditioner QL03 However, at this time of year, the sun sets in Hokkaido around 7pm, so it can be said that it hasn't changed much. Even so, there is a drop of about 2 degrees at the temperature than at the start, and about 3 degrees at the WBGT (heat index), so there is a big difference. When camping in the middle of summer, it is recommended to use it actively if you can use an air conditioning system such as a spot cooler before you think it's dangerous.

    In the case of the "Haier JA-SP25U Spot Air Conditioner", hot air is discharged from the main unit, so only cold air is sent into the tent. Therefore, the cold air sealing felt low.

    Summary: Set up your tent in the shade in the summer and actively use air conditioning.

    The interior of the "DX Octagon 460UV" is quite spacious. In the shade, I think that Gen's Spot Air Conditioner QL03 and JH01 Circulator from Chestnut have been able to cool it down sufficiently.

    In this test, I was so concerned that the results would not be useful in experiments in cool environments in Hokkaido, so I deliberately experimented on a day when direct sunlight was bright in the middle of summer, but this season, the heat in Hokkaido remains unchanged, so in the end, it may not have been necessary to go this far.

    If the tent was installed in the shade or shaded trees, as was the case in line with the tent, a combination of spot air conditioners and JH01 circulators could have kept the heat index low enough, and the environment could be maintained to be comfortable inside the tent. Rather, even in Hokkaido, on days when the weather forecast forecasts show that the temperature exceeds 30 degrees, campsite day and tents installed there are basically "life-threatening and dangerous heat." Therefore, as a basic premise, when camping in the middle of summer, be sure to take great care and choose the location where you will be installing your tent.

    Also, this time I the DX Octagon 460UV mats, allowing me to enjoy a very spacious and comfortable space, but the spot air conditioner QL03 is a spot cooler that can accommodate 7 tatami mats at 50Hz for wooden buildings, 9 tatami mats at 60Hz for 9 tatami mats at 50Hz, 8 tatami mats at 50Hz for reinforced and prefabricated steels, and 10 tatami mats at 60Hz, so I felt that there was a lack of power to use in a tent. You could also choose to make the spot cooler even more powerful to match the DX Octagon 460UV DX Octagon 400UV It seems that a tent with a lower sealing degree will require a larger spot cooler output.

    In either case, we found that in a summer camp where it is "life-threatening and dangerous" level, the heat inside the midday tent will seriously make you feel life-threatening. When installing a tent, we recommend that you control the shady trees and shade, and properly temperatures, and if necessary, actively use air conditioning goods such as spot coolers and circulators to prepare your tent so you can have a comfortable atmosphere.

    It is also important to check in advance whether there are any coolers or other items in the campsite reception and front desk spaces where you can evacuate from the heat in emergencies. It's camping, so if you feel more heat than necessary, we recommend using a spot cooler immediately.
